Die Zeit unter der Lupe 730/1964 21.12.1964

Synopsis

01 Erhard in London - Ludwig Erhard is located at the station in London (total) English Cabinet members. Erhard speaks before the microphone between representatives of the press (total). Erhard goes next to Lord Douglas Home through a door into the courtroom (total). Erhard next to Schröder at the table sitting (wide). Großaufnanme Erhard, close-up Schröder, laughing.

02. Lübke opened the Central Office for economic development aid in Munich - Lübke speaks (large). Various settings of the listener, in part from developing countries. Long shot of the Hall and clapping the participants 03. de Gaulle speaks in the round radio on Chinapolotik - de Gaulle (half close) close-up of the head of a French helmet and presented Saber guards.

04. Segni in Johnson and Arlington - Johnson welcomes Segni (half total) the White House, side total. Segni, beside him the interpreter and Johnson sit opposite (half total). Segni at the grave of Kennedy in Arlington (total). Close-up of the snow-covered grave of Kennedy.

05. Jacqueline Kennedy says thanks for participating in the death of her husband at press conference. -Close-up Jacqueline Kennedy. She sits with Brothers Robert Kennedy and Edward Kennedy before a fireplace (half total). Robert and Edward Kennedy alone in the picture (half close). Close-up of Jaqueline Kennedy speaking.

06. Turkish guest workers in the Bundesbahn - on the platform of a railway car is a Turkish migrant worker and sings (half close). Railway workers work on snow-covered tracks (total). The workers go with shouldered tools at the break (total). A worker in a construction train rises (half total). 2 workers wash your hands in a bowl (large). Close-up compass in the hand of a man. Large wind rose to the ceiling. Rite of prayer towards kneel to Mecca (half close), and bow and throw to the ground. Close-ups of the faces of workers, serious. Long shot of the workers back at work on the tracks. Notes Dr Jane "I like. "it you in Germany?" Close-up: Interpreter speaks. Close-up shots of Turkish workers faces. The workers sit around a table, one plays guitar (half total). Close up hand with glass. A Gatsarbeiter drink (half total). Close-up of the hand that plays on Zupfgeige.
